Artem Dziuba did not agree to stay at Zenit for 2 million euros

Zenit striker Artem Dziuba could have stayed in the St. Petersburg club in 2022, but did not want to. According to Sport24, citing an informed source, even a very tempting contract did not help to keep the player.
Dziuba was offered a new contract for 2 million euros a year at Zenit in the summer, including bonuses. However, the player refused, as well as from the offer of the Saudi Arabian team – for 3 million euros a year. According to the source of the publication, Dziuba was not interested then in money, as well as in the transfer window – he had new challenges as a priority.
Artem Dzyuba left the blue-white-blue team in the summer of 2022. Since then, he managed to try to continue his career in the Turkish club Adana Demirspor, but left it in November. Since then, the player has been in free flight.
Earlier, “MK in St. Petersburg” said that Artem Dzyuba could not interest the club “Pari NN“.
